महाकालेश्वरं देवि कलौ नाम प्रकीर्तितम् । कालरूपी महारुद्रस्तस्मिंल्लिंगे व्यवस्थितः
mahākāleśvaraṃ devi kalau nāma prakīrtitam | kālarūpī mahārudrastasmiṃlliṃge vyavasthitaḥ
Oh Diosa, en la era de Kali se le celebra con el nombre de Mahākāleśvara. Allí, el Gran Rudra—encarnación del Tiempo—permanece establecido en ese liṅga.
